Product Overview
The ABB 1TGE120021R0010 is a specialized digital input/output (I/O) module designed for ABB’s Relion® 615 series of protection and control relays. This module serves as a critical expansion unit, providing additional binary (on/off) signal interfaces to enhance the relay’s capability to interact with the primary equipment in a substation. The ABB 1TGE120021R0010 module allows the RED615, REF615, or other 615 series relays to monitor more status contacts (like circuit breaker position, isolator status, or pressure alarms) and command more control outputs (for tripping, closing, or alarm annunciation). By integrating the ABB 1TGE120021R0010, engineers can customize the I/O capacity of the relay to precisely match the requirements of a specific feeder or bay, eliminating the need for external auxiliary relays in many cases. This module exemplifies the modular and scalable design philosophy of the Relion platform.

Application Case Studies
-
Complex Ring Main Unit (RMU) Protection: For a 2-circuit RMU with sectionalizing switches, the standard I/O on a RED615 relay might be insufficient. Adding the ABB 1TGE120021R0010 provides extra binary inputs to monitor all switch positions (2 breakers + 1 sectionalizer) and extra outputs to control all three mechanisms and signal local/remote status.
-
Transformer Feeder with Multiple Alarms: Protecting a transformer feeder requires not just overcurrent protection but also monitoring of transformer ancillary equipment. The expansion module adds inputs for Buchholz relay, winding temperature, oil level, and pressure relief device alarms, allowing a single relay to manage both protection and comprehensive condition monitoring.
-
Automated Feeder with Recloser Control: In an application requiring a reclosing sequence with status feedback for each attempt, the additional outputs from the 1TGE120021R0010 can be used for the close commands, while the extra inputs confirm the breaker status after each close operation, enabling sophisticated logic within the relay.
